Why Typical Waterproofing Is a Trouble
For decades, the gold standard for waterproof efficiency was PFAS-- per- and polyfluoroalkyl substances, generally called "forever chemicals." Made use of in long lasting water repellent (DWR) finishings put on tents, rainfall jackets, and tarpaulins, PFAS are very efficient at fending off water. Regrettably, they are additionally astonishingly relentless. They gather in soil, groundwater, wildlife, and human cells, and have actually been connected to a series of wellness issues. When you pitch an outdoor tents treated with conventional DWR coatings in an excellent alpine field, traces of those chemicals can leach right into the very setting you concerned enjoy.
Past coverings, many water resistant membranes-- like those made from polyvinyl chloride (PVC)-- are originated from petrochemicals and are notoriously tough to recycle. The exterior gear we rely on has actually historically brought a significant environmental impact.
The Surge of PFAS-Free Waterproof Technologies
The change far from forever chemicals is currently well underway. A number of innovative choices now supply comparable water resistance without the hazardous legacy.
Fluorine-Free DWR Coatings
Brands and chemical business have actually developed DWR therapies based upon plant-derived waxes, silicones, and polyurethane compounds. These finishes break down far more safely in the setting. While earlier versions dragged PFAS in raw efficiency, formulations have actually boosted significantly, and numerous fluorine-free DWR products now do very well in real-world camping problems. They do call for more regular reapplication, which is a reasonable trade-off for environmental comfort.
Bio-Based and Recycled Membrane Layers
Waterproof-breathable membranes-- the inner layer that obstructs rainfall while allowing wetness vapor to run away-- have generally relied upon expanded polytetrafluoroethylene (ePTFE) or polyurethane movies derived from fossil fuels. Newer choices consist of membrane layers made from recycled polyester, bio-based polyurethane derived from corn or castor oil, and also speculative cellulose-based films. These materials minimize dependancy on virgin petrochemicals while keeping the breathability important for active use in the outdoors.
Lasting Fabrics Well Worth Recognizing
Beyond coverings and membranes, the base materials utilized in outdoor camping equipment are additionally evolving.
Recycled Nylon and Polyester
Much of the waterproof summer camp wedding nylon and polyester utilized in outdoors tents, rain fly covers, and dry bags can now be sourced from post-consumer recycled material-- including recovered angling internet, plastic containers, and commercial material waste. Recycled synthetics utilize considerably much less power and water to create than virgin products and draw away plastic from garbage dumps and oceans. Numerous leading outside brands now provide camping tents and packs made mainly from recycled textiles without giving up longevity or water-proof efficiency.
Waxed Canvas and All-natural Fibers
Standard waxed canvas is experiencing a real rebirth amongst campers who value longevity over lightweight convenience. Made from tightly woven cotton treated with natural paraffin or plant-based waxes, waxed canvas sheds water effectively, ages beautifully, and-- most importantly-- can be re-waxed in the house to expand its life-span forever. A properly maintained waxed canvas outdoor tents or tarpaulin can last decades, substantially lowering the demand for substitute.
Dyneema Compound Textile
Initially created for high-performance cruising, Dyneema Compound Fabric (DCF) is an ultralight, highly water-proof product progressively utilized in ultralight camping shelters and completely dry bags. While it is an artificial material, its extraordinary durability suggests equipment made from it lasts far longer than conventional alternatives-- and long life is itself a type of sustainability.
Making Smarter Selections as a Camper
Selecting sustainable waterproof gear is not just regarding what products are made from-- it is also concerning exactly how you take care of them. Correctly cleaning, drying, and re-treating DWR coverings extends the life of your equipment and minimizes the frequency of substitute. Purchasing from brands that supply repair service programs, take-back plans, or lifetime service warranties additional compounds the ecological benefit.
The most lasting piece of gear is the one you currently have, maintained well and used for as long as feasible.
